Implications: Two Factors: 1. Apple will have less revenue. 2. Europe tells everyone we are one.
Analysis: On the surface this just looks like Apple will have to price its music the same through out, as they call it, the "Eurozone." The implications are that Apple will lose 10% revenue in their sales in Great Britain and that is the end of the story. But I see this in much broader terms and not only effecting Apple but other that sell across all of Europe.
What could be next:
Software - After all music is software will the regulators take this to the next step and say an OS or other software must have the same price in the Eurozone?
iPhone - Then must the iPhone be the same price for the service all over Europe?
Hardware from the same company be it Apple or Dell or HP or Phillips or even a toaster oven?
Winning this battle with Apple could open the door for the ones in the Eurozone working towards a one nation status of all of Europe.
